Subject: RE: HSR Question - Mortgage Origination
Without the associated mortgages, the acquisition of the origination platform is not exempt under 7A(c}(2).

Subject: RE: HSR Question - Mortgage Origination
There are a few mortgages being sold, but just ones that are between origination and sale in the ordinary course. The target company is not in the business of holding mortgages, it sells them off as fast as it can after originating them, but keeps the servicing rights. (In my example, I didn't ask about servicing rights, because they are clearly reportable but in this deal are valued below the size of transaction threshold.)

Subject: HSR Question - Mortgage Origination
Kate,
I am clear that the sale of mortgages Is exempt, and that the sale of mortgage servicing rights (separate from the underlying mortgages) outside of the ordinary course is reportable.
In reviewing informal interpretations, I saw one that suggested mortgage origination was treated as exempt under the mortgage exemption, regardless of whether in the ordinary course or not. So can you confirm that the sale. of a business that only originates mortgages (also called an origination platform) is exempt under the mortgage exemption? This would mean the sale of a company that has many offices with employees who originate mortgages and it only originates and sells off the mortgages and servicing rights to the mortgages that it originated.
